Ticket VLT-218: Receipt mailer vault locked — Goodhollow Giving

For new team members: the credentials vault for the ReceiptRunner donation-receipt mailer has auto-locked after the quarterly rotation ran twice in error. Until it is reopened, scheduled receipt batches for the Harwick campaign will queue but not send. Do not restart the mailer service; queued jobs are idempotent and will drain once the vault is unsealed. Verify the audit log shows no sends during the lockout window. Unseal the vault using the recovery passphrase below.

unlock words, kagef-taduf: fenir-quenix-norwyn-sorvan-gormir-gorir-fraok

TICKET: Config drift on Inkbarrow renderer

The Inkbarrow PDF invoice renderer in prod no longer matches what's committed in the Hollyvale config repo. Someone hand-edited the page margin and concurrency settings on two of the four nodes, so invoices render inconsistently depending on which replica serves the request. Need a reviewer to confirm which side is canonical before we reconcile. For reference, the values currently live on the drifted nodes are listed below.

service settings:
[casax]
port = 6379
team = rusir
host = casax.zemvarhq.corp
region = outer-4
access_code = ac_9808ce
timeout_ms = 1500

Markdown pipeline runbook — Ferngate renderer. If preview output is blank, check the Slateroot sanitizer stage first; it silently drops documents over 2MB. Restart the worker pool, then replay the failed queue from the Mirrowell dashboard. Do not clear the cache unless rendering errors persist after replay. Escalate to the Ferngate on-call if replay loops twice. Verification requires the trace token from the last successful replay, shown below.

trace token, yahif-kagep: htk31_bd0cc6b1d7ab4f7094c586a5de900e0

## Authentication

Heads up: the nightly reindex job (`reindex_nightly.py`) talks to the Lanternfish search cluster, and that cluster won't accept anonymous writes anymore — we locked it down last sprint. The job now authenticates as the `reindex-runner` service identity against Corvid Gateway, and the token is injected via the `LF_INDEX_TOKEN` env var in the scheduler config. Nothing clever going on, just a bearer header on every batch request. For review purposes, the staging credential currently in use is listed below.

service key, kadug-kadup: kto15_rN23XLAYImmZgrJ